How they compare

Bangladesh currently reports 86.0% against 85.0% in San Marino, a difference of 1.0%.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 26 shared years of data; in 2000 it was San Marino ahead.

Bangladesh ranks 85th and San Marino ranks 88th of 194 countries.

Across the 3 decades both report, Bangladesh averaged higher in 1 and San Marino in 2.

Head to head by decade

Decade Bangladesh San Marino Difference Ahead
2000s 0.0% 65.4% 65.4% San Marino
2010s 67.3% 85.0% 17.7% San Marino
2020s 91.8% 81.7% 10.2% Bangladesh

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
